Healthy HoMAEd Breakfast : Fudge Brownie Baked Oatmeal! High Protein!

As always I provided substitutions and alternatives for you because I do not want a specific brand or product to hold you back from giving this recipe a try :) 




Ingredients

  • 40g Oats
  • 1 Scoop of Whey I used Cellucor Cookies + Cream
  • 5g or 1TB Cocoa Powder
  • 4g Lillys Chocolate chips ( they are sweetened with stevia! )
  • 2 TB Coconut Flour ( You can use any flour yo like )
  • 1 Tb Stevia  ( Or agave, honey, coconut sugar )
  • 8 oz Water
  • 1/4 Tsp Baking Powder
  • 1/4 Tsp Vanilla Extract
  • Pinch of Himalayan Salt ( Sea Salt is fine ) 
Optional 

Whip Cream or Truvia
I used Waldens Farms Chocolate Syrup 


Preheat your oven to 350 F
Spray an oven-safe dish with non-stick spray
Combine all of your ingredients 
Bake for 30-35 minutes.
You can adjust the time depending on the texture you wish to have. There are no eggs in this dish so if your want a more pudding like texture, lessen the bake time... it will be like a lava cake :)

HomeMAEd: Perfect Fit Almond + Oat Protein Cookies

With the Tone it up Bikini Series in Full swing we thought we would share one our favorite new recipes! These littles cookies are and aMAEzing post workout treat! We like to Keep them in the freezer during the summer to make healthy ice cream sandwiches or crumple them up in our breakfast smoothie bowls! 


Here is what you will need! 


  • 1 Scoop of Perfect Fit Protein ( or whatever type of protein powder you use)
  • 1 Tb Coconut Flour
  • 1 TB Flax Meal
  • 1/2 cup Gluten Free Steel Cut Oats
  • 2 TB Coconut Sugar
  • 1/2 Banana ( Mashed ) 
  • 1 Tb Almond Butter ( We LOVE Crunchy! )
  • 1 TB Coconut Oil 
  • 1 Egg White 
  • Splash of Almond Milk
  • 2 Droppers of Liquid Stevia ( or 2 TB powdered 
  • 1/8 tsp Baking soda
  • 1/8 tsp Baking Powder
  • Pinch of Himalayan Sea Salt 
Optional 

We also added in 1 tsp of homeMAEd cranberry almond butter and cocoa nibs! 

Combine all of your ingredients, line a baking sheet with parchment paper and spray with nonstick spray. We love this coconut oil spray


Scoop about 1 1/2 Tb of dough per cookie and press onto baking sheet.
Preheat your oven to 350F and Bake of about 10-13 minutes

When the cookies come out of the over sprinkle a little bit of coconut sugar on top... you will thank us later :)
